What are some typical challenges faced by Google Cloud Security Engineers in their daily work?

Google Cloud Security Engineers often encounter challenges such as keeping up with rapidly changing security threats, ensuring compliance with industry regulations, and integrating security best practices into agile development environments. They are tasked with configuring security controls, monitoring for vulnerabilities, and responding to incident alerts, often working alongside development, operations, and compliance teams. Staying current with new GCP features and collaborating with colleagues to develop scalable, secure solutions is a crucial part of the role. Overcoming these challenges provides opportunities for professional growth and makes a direct impact on an organization's overall cloud security posture.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Google Cloud Security Engineer?

To thrive as a Google Cloud Security Engineer, you need expertise in cloud architecture, cybersecurity principles, and hands-on experience with Google Cloud Platform (GCP). Familiarity with tools like Security Command Center, Cloud IAM, VPC Service Controls, and certifications such as Google Professional Cloud Security Engineer are highly valued. Strong problem-solving abilities, collaboration, and clear communication skills help you work effectively within cross-functional teams. These skills are essential for proactively identifying vulnerabilities, implementing robust security measures, and ensuring the integrity of cloud-based systems.

What is a Google Cloud Security Engineer?

A Google Cloud Security Engineer is responsible for designing, implementing, and maintaining security controls on Google Cloud Platform (GCP). They ensure cloud environments are protected against threats by managing identity and access management (IAM), network security, data protection, and compliance. Their role includes monitoring security risks, responding to incidents, and enforcing best practices to safeguard cloud workloads. They also work closely with developers and IT teams to integrate security into cloud applications and infrastructure.
